Overview

ScrapeUnblocker renders web pages in a real browser behind anti-bot protections such as Cloudflare, DataDome, PerimeterX and Akamai. Use it when an ordinary HTTP request returns a block page, a captcha, or an empty JavaScript shell instead of the content you need.

The integration provides two components:

You need a ScrapeUnblocker API key to use both. Get one at scrapeunblocker.com and expose it as SCRAPEUNBLOCKER_API_KEY, which both components read by default.

Installation

pip install scrapeunblocker-haystack

Usage

ScrapeUnblockerFetcher

Fetches URLs and returns one Document per page.

Basic Example

from scrapeunblocker_haystack import ScrapeUnblockerFetcher

fetcher = ScrapeUnblockerFetcher()
result = fetcher.run(urls=["https://example.com"])

print(result["documents"][0].content[:200])

Parameters

Parameter Default Description
api_key SCRAPEUNBLOCKER_API_KEY env var ScrapeUnblocker API key
parsed_data False Return AI-parsed structured JSON instead of raw HTML
proxy_country None Two-letter country code for the exit IP
time_sleep None Seconds to wait after load before capturing
base_url https://api.scrapeunblocker.com API base URL
timeout 180 HTTP timeout in seconds
raise_on_failure False Raise instead of skipping a URL that fails

By default a URL that cannot be fetched is logged and skipped, so one bad URL does not discard the rest of the batch.

ScrapeUnblockerWebSearch

Searches Google and returns the organic results as Documents, with the snippet as content and title / link / position in the metadata.

Basic Example

from scrapeunblocker_haystack import ScrapeUnblockerWebSearch

search = ScrapeUnblockerWebSearch(top_k=5)
result = search.run(query="best web scraping api")

for doc in result["documents"]:
    print(doc.meta["title"], doc.meta["link"])

Parameters

Parameter Default Description
api_key SCRAPEUNBLOCKER_API_KEY env var ScrapeUnblocker API key
pages_to_check 1 How many result pages to scrape
proxy_country None Two-letter country code for localised results
top_k None Keep at most this many results
base_url https://api.scrapeunblocker.com API base URL
timeout 180 HTTP timeout in seconds

In a Pipeline

Fetch a protected page and answer questions about it. ScrapeUnblockerFetcher already emits Document objects, so it connects straight to the prompt builder - no HTML-to-Document conversion step is needed:

from haystack import Pipeline
from haystack.components.builders import ChatPromptBuilder
from haystack.components.generators.chat import OpenAIChatGenerator
from haystack.dataclasses import ChatMessage

from scrapeunblocker_haystack import ScrapeUnblockerFetcher

prompt = [
    ChatMessage.from_user(
        "Answer the question using the pages below.\n\n"
        "{% for doc in documents %}{{ doc.content }}\n{% endfor %}\n"
        "Question: {{ question }}"
    )
]

pipe = Pipeline()
pipe.add_component("fetcher", ScrapeUnblockerFetcher())
pipe.add_component("prompt_builder", ChatPromptBuilder(template=prompt, required_variables="*"))
pipe.add_component("llm", OpenAIChatGenerator())

pipe.connect("fetcher.documents", "prompt_builder.documents")
pipe.connect("prompt_builder.prompt", "llm.messages")

result = pipe.run(
    {
        "fetcher": {"urls": ["https://example.com"]},
        "prompt_builder": {"question": "What is this page about?"},
    }
)
print(result["llm"]["replies"][0].text)

Both components implement to_dict() and from_dict(), so pipelines using them can be serialized and reloaded. The API key is stored as a Haystack Secret reference rather than its value.
